Berry Recruitment is looking for a Catering Duty Manager to assist overseeing the food and beverage outlets at a unique activity farm and theme park and to ensure its catering operation is delivered to the highest possible standard. THIS IS A TEMPORARY ROLE COVERING MATERNITY LEAVE FOR APPROX 10 TO 12 MONTHS - STARTING ASAP.

The role would suit someone happy to jump in and work in a busy and very enjoyable family environment where no two days are the same. With themed events throughout the year and especially at Christmas this is a FUN place to work!

As Catering Duty Manager you will be responsible for leading a team to ensure that Health & Safety, Food Safety, operational excellence and customer service standards are operationally consistently delivered and maintained. You will be part of a Catering management team of three intent on driving the catering offering forward. There are 2 main catering facilities that operate similar to cafes as well as a few huts offering snacks and coffees, ice creams etc. Specifics can be discussed if you are interested.

Hours of Work:

Those necessary for the performance of your duties. This role demands a flexible approach to working hours to reflect the needs of the business at weekends, Bank Holidays and school holidays. The average working week will be 5 days in 7, which will include at least one weekend day each week.

Current opening hours of the business are 10am to 5.30pm, with a 9am management start time.

However, start and finish times will need to reflect the needs of the business and your role as a Manager within it.
